The Hobart Brickies will venture away from home to take on the Griffith Panthers at 6:30 p.m. on Monday.
On Thursday, Hobart didn't have quite enough to beat Andrean and fell 3-2. The Brickies have now taken an 'L' in back-to-back matches.
Hobart wouldn't go down easily and took Andrean into a fifth set but they suffered a heartbreaking ten-point loss. The final score came out to 25-17, 25-21, 21-25, 25-27, 15-5.
Meanwhile, there's no place like home for Griffith, who bounced back after a loss on the road on Tuesday. They walked away with a 3-1 win over River Forest on Thursday. The victory was some much needed relief for the Panthers as it spelled an end to their three-match losing streak.
Griffith had a slow start but a hot finish: after dropping the first set, they turned around to win the next three. The match finished with set scores of 21-25, 25-22, 25-16, 25-19.
Hobart better focus on containing Charlee Prutsman and Milah Castro as the pair were huge in Griffith's win. Prutsman had 13 assists and five digs, while Castro had 13 digs. Those 13 assists gave Prutsman a new career-high.
Griffith's win bumped their record up to 9-10. As for Hobart, their loss dropped their record down to 9-14.
Hobart took their victory against Griffith when the teams last played back in October of 2024 by a conclusive 3-0 score. The rematch might be a little tougher for the Brickies since the team won't have the home-court advantage this time around. We'll see if the change in venue makes a difference.
